I don't yet have a job offer, but I have a couple of promising interviews in a few days and I want to be prepared. It's in the graphic design field. I know I need a passport, college diploma, job offer and job description. But I wanted to look over the actually application that I'd take to the border.

But yes, when I have the offer for employment, it would be for the NAFTA/TN work permit.

Maybe I use the same forms as all other applicants? I thought there would be a specific set of documents for NAFTA. That's all I need to know.
Do I use the same forms? I'd post a link to the documents I'm talking about, but I can't.

Document IMM id's 1295, 5645, 5257 ?

Thanks

There are no separate set of forms. You don't have to complete them, the Immigration officer completes them when you arrive at the border with your job and proof that it is NAFTA compliant and you are qualified.
